To be honest, my impression is that they're all the same. I haven't read anything that leads me to believe that one is significantly better than the other. I even think that a basic DWR spray like Nikwax might be fine.

The usual recommendations include Saphir Invulner and Tarrago Nano Protector. But there are dozens of similar products -- nearly every shoe brand offers their own bottle (e.g. Alden, Allen Edmonds, Lucchese, Viberg, Tecovas, etc). I know many sneakerheads who use Scotchgard. Jason Markk sells a waterproofer.

I use Allen Edmonds and find it works well. I've tried Saphir and Tarrago and think they also work well, but not better than Allen Edmonds.

The only thing I've read is that some people believe you should avoid ones with silicone.
